The VIU Faculty Association’s Status of Women Committee called upon community leaders, service providers, educators, activists, and citizens to participate in our second annual video campaign supporting 16 Days of Activism Against Gender-based Violence, an international campaign led by the United Nations. View our 2020 campaign here.

This campaign runs from November 25, 2021 (International Day for the Elimination of Violence against Women) to December 10, 2021 (Human Rights Day). 

Our video campaign aims to raise awareness and to motivate action and accountability all year round. This year, we extended special invitations to vital organizations and educators to contribute informational videos about issues ranging from gaslighting, to pornography’s impact on children, to risk reduction strategies for BIPOC communities. In solidarity with the UN theme “Orange the World,” the Canadian Federation of University Women (CFUW) Nanaimo and VIUFA’s Status of Women Committee created two orange light displays for the period of Nov.25-Dec.10. One is located at the Bastion on Front Street in downtown Nanaimo, and other is located in the Quad area of VIU’s Nanaimo campus, near the Cafeteria and Malaspina’s Theatre. Banners, located at both locations, declare: UNiTE TO END VIOLENCE AGAINST WOMEN.
